Colin Kaepernick apparently wants out of San Francisco, and he specifically has the Jets in mind as a new home. 

When Chip Kelly was hired as the new head coach of the San Francisco 49ers, everyone started talking about what he might do to fix quarterback Colin Kaepernick. On paper, despite his struggles last season, Kaepernick seems like the perfect signal caller for the Kelly system and this new marriage seemed downright perfect.

Well, it might not all be sunshine and rainbows. Although Kelly might indeed be able to fix Kaepernick, the 49ers quarterback doesn’t really want to be in the Bay Area anymore.

According to a report from the New York Daily News, Kaepernick does completely want out of San Francisco following the way he played this past season. But, it doesn’t all end there. No, in addition to the former Super Bowl quarterback wanting to find a home other than San Francisco, he apparently has a destination in mind — the New York Jets.

Now this puts the Jets in quite the position. Last season, the first under head coach Todd Bowles, the team nearly saw themselves playing in the postseason behind the arm of Ryan Fitzpatrick. Fitzpatrick didn’t like the world on fire as a Pro Bowl-quarterback by any means, but he did do an outstanding job for the most part of just managing the offense.

So in reality, the Jets would have to ask themselves whether or not it would be worth the risk to bring in Kaepernick and give him the nod over Fitzpatrick. Sure, he had his good years in San Francisco under Jim Harbaugh, but last year was just a complete disaster all around.

The Jets have a lot of evaluating to do if they are actually interested in a move such as this, but it’s something interesting to keep an eye on nonetheless this off-season.
